REG6 is an always-on, low-dropout linear regulator  
(LDO) that is optimized for RTC and backup-battery  
applications. REG6 features low-quiescent supply  
current, current-limit protection, and reverse-current  
protection, and is ideally suited for always-on power  
supply applications, such as for a real-time clock, or  
as a backup-battery or super-cap charger.

As shown in Figure 10, REG6 features a CC/CV  
output characteristic, regulating its output voltage  
for load currents up to 30mA, and regulating output  
current when the load exceeds (typically) 60mA.

Reverse-Current Protection  
REG6 features internal circuitry that limits the  
reverse supply current to less than 1µA when the  
input voltage falls below the output voltage, as can  
be encountered in backup-battery charging  
applications. REG6's internal circuitry monitors the  
input and the output, and disconnects internal  
circuitry and parasitic diodes when the input voltage  
falls below the output voltage, greatly minimizing  
backup battery discharge.

Voltage Regulators  
REG6 is ideally suited for always-on voltage-  
regulation applications, such as for real-time clock  
and memory keep-alive applications. This regulator  
requires only a small ceramic capacitor with a  
minimum capacitance of 1μF for stability. For best  
performance, the output capacitor should be  
connected directly between the output and GA, with  
a short and direct connection.
